| Clutton's j. |
painless symmetrical hydrarthrosis, especially of the knee joints, seen in congenital syphilis.

| cluster |
This is the unit of disk storage used by the operating system. A cluster consists of one or several logical disk sectors, located sequentially. The length of a cluster on floppy disks is usually 1 or 2 sectors, on hard disks it is generally 4 or 8.

| cluster |
In a set of elements, a cluster is a subset of elements that are relatively near each other and relatively far and separated from other elements. To "cluster" a set is to identify the sets of similar elements. For example, a set of documents could be clustered so that documents on the same topics are put in separate clusters -- identified by the presence of the same low frequency words.
